Practical Designer Notes You’ll Actually Use

Before committing this Ocean Animal Bold and Easy Coloring Book to client work or physical production, here’s what I test every time:

  1. Print it at actual label size—does the line weight stay legible at 0.75” height?
  2. Check black-and-white output—some “bold” lines vanish on low-ink printers if contrast isn’t optimized.
  3. Layer it over your brand palette—does it sing in your coral + charcoal combo, or mute your signature sage?
  4. Preview alongside your fonts—it pairs strongly with rounded sans serifs and gentle scripts, but can overwhelm delicate handwritten styles.
  5. Verify file formats—if you need scalable flexibility, confirm SVG or vector-ready EPS files are included (not just PNGs).
  6. Review commercial license terms—this is non-negotiable for product labels, packaging design, or any physical goods sold publicly.
  7. Compare against competitor packaging—does it help you stand out on a crowded shelf, or blend in?
